There's an interesting angle to this new ranking by Homesnacks of the states with the most prisoners. It's not the raw number of jailbirds within the state, but one of those "per capita" things.

The helpful map that Nick Johnson of Homesnacks included shows how each state ranked. Generally speaking the bluer the state, the more prisoners per person that are held captive there. Illinois is a very pretty shade of blue. Again it says "most people behind bars per capita".
